Panaji, January 19: Ahead of the Goa Assembly elections 2022, the Bharatiya Janata Party (BJP) on Thursday announced a list of 34 candidates. Goa Chief Minister Pramod Sawant will be contesting from Sanquelim. In a list of 34 candidates, BJP has deployed Chief Minister Pramod Sawant from Sanquelim and Deputy CM Manohar Ajgaonkar from Margao.
